Summary

Lit Protocol, a decentralized platform for digital keys and private compute is seeking a talented and tenacious Senior Software Engineer to join our team.
The focus of this role will be on the core Lit Protocol infrastructure, where you will have ownership over the features you implement and be expected to think critically about how they align with the overall product vision and customer needs. If you're passionate about building innovative, open, secure, and private systems that empower users, and have a never-give-up attitude coupled with a pragmatic approach to problem-solving, this is the perfect opportunity for you.

Key Responsibilities

  • Design, develop, and maintain core features of the Lit Protocol infrastructure using Rust.
  • Collaborate with the team to align feature development with the overall product vision.
  • Write clean, efficient, and well-documented code that adheres to best practices.
  • Contribute to the development of smart contracts and their integration with the Lit Protocol.
  • Analyze and optimize system performance, ensuring scalability and reliability.
  • Actively participate in code reviews and provide constructive feedback to team members.
  • Stay up-to-date with the latest trends and technologies in the decentralized web space.

Qualifications

  • Take ownership and responsibility for features, from conceptualization to implementation, always keeping the end-user in mind.
  • Strong proficiency in Rust programming language and a willingness to expand your knowledge.
  • Familiarly with blockchain systems and smart contracts. 
  • Excellent logical thinking skills and ability to build high-assurance systems.
  • Proven track record of delivering high-quality code in a timely manner, even in the face of challenges.
  • Experience in independently driving projects in a fast-paced environment with a positive attitude.
  • Ability to give and receive constructive feedback effectively.
  • Exceptional written and verbal communication skills on both technical and non-technical topics.

Preferred Qualifications

  • Located in San Francisco.
  • Experience writing smart contracts.
  • Prior experience in building decentralized systems.
  • Knowledge of cryptography and its applications.

What you need to know about the Austin Tech Scene

Austin has a diverse and thriving tech ecosystem thanks to home-grown companies like Dell and major campuses for IBM, AMD and Apple. The state’s flagship university, the University of Texas at Austin, is known for its engineering school, and the city is known for its annual South by Southwest tech and media conference. Austin’s tech scene spans many verticals, but it’s particularly known for hardware, including semiconductors, as well as AI, biotechnology and cloud computing. And its food and music scene, low taxes and favorable climate has made the city a destination for tech workers from across the country.

Key Facts About Austin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 180,500; 13.7%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Dell, IBM, AMD, Apple, Alphabet
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, hardware, cloud computing, software, healthtech
  • Funding Landscape: $4.5 billion in VC fun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Live Oak Ventures, Austin Ventures, Hinge Capital, Gigafund, KdT Ventures, Next Coast Ventures, Silverton Partners
  • Research Centers and Universities: University of Texas, Southwestern University, Texas State University, Center for Complex Quantum Systems, Oden Institute for Computational Engineering and Sciences, Texas Advanced Computing Center
